Update
Fabiola Greenawalt
May 31, 2023
The Russell Family Foundation
April 13, 2023
January 24, 2023
October 18, 2022
August 1, 2022
April 20, 2022
March 31, 2022
March 23, 2022
The Russell Family Foundation is Committing to Net Zero. Read the full announcement here